  • Title

    The configuration of EV system using battery module balancing method

  • Abstract
    In the electric vehicle(EV) system, the Technology for the efficient operation of a battery is one of the most important technologies. By the voltage difference between the cell and between modules of electric car battery, it will not be able to efficiently use the battery. Using the voltage balancing method to each of the battery modules to increase the available space for the battery module, it is possible to more efficient battery operation. This paper provide the EV system of applying the Balancing method of the battery module and the torque control of interior permanent magnet synchronous motor(IPMSM) for EV using this method.
